template <typename T> class AStar {
|
|
|
|
public:
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
//dijkstra with priority queue O(E log V)
|
|
template <typename Access> static std::vector<const T*> get(const T* source, const T* destination, Access acc) {
|
|
|
|
// track distances from the source to each other node
|
|
std::unordered_map<const T*, float> distance;
|
|
|
|
// track the previous node for each node along the path
|
|
std::unordered_map<const T*, const T*> parent;
|
|
|
|
// all nodes
|
|
const std::vector<T>& nodes = acc.getAllNodes();
|
|
|
|
// priority queue to check which node is to-be-processed next
|
|
std::priority_queue<std::pair<T*,float>, std::vector<std::pair<const T*,float>>, Comparator2> Q;
|
|
|
|
// start with infinite distance
|
|
for(const auto& node : nodes){
|
|
distance[&node] = std::numeric_limits<float>::max();
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
// start at the source
|
|
distance[source] = 0.0f;
|
|
Q.push(std::make_pair(source,distance[source]));
|
|
|
|
int iter = 0;
|
|
//std::cout << (std::string)*source << std::endl;
|
|
//std::cout << (std::string)*destination << std::endl;
|
|
|
|
// proceed until there are now new nodes to follow
|
|
while(!Q.empty()) {
|
|
|
|
++iter;
|
|
|
|
// fetch the next-nearest node from the queue
|
|
const T* u = Q.top().first;
|
|
|
|
// and check whether we reached the destination
|
|
if (u == destination) {break;}
|
|
|
|
// remove from the Queue
|
|
Q.pop();
|
|
|
|
// process all neighbors for the current element
|
|
for( const T& v : acc.getNeighbors(*u)) {
|
|
|
|
// weight (distance) between the current node and its neighbor
|
|
//const float w = ((Point3)v - (Point3)*u).length();
|
|
const float w = acc.getWeightBetween(v, *u);
|
|
|
|
// found a better route?
|
|
if (distance[&v] > distance[u] + w) {
|
|
distance[&v] = distance[u] + w;
|
|
parent[&v] = u;
|
|
Q.push(std::make_pair(&v, distance[&v] + acc.getHeuristic(v, *destination)));
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
//std::cout << iter << std::endl;
|
|
|
|
|
|
// construct the path
|
|
std::vector<const T*> path;
|
|
const T* p = destination;
|
|
path.push_back(destination);
|
|
|
|
// until we reached the source-node
|
|
while (p!=source) {
|
|
if (p) {
|
|
p = parent[p];
|
|
path.push_back(p);
|
|
} else {
|
|
return std::vector<const T*>(); //if no path could be found, just return an empty vector.
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// done
|
|
return path;
|
|
|
|
}
